- Alloying of disordered GaInP with nitrogen is shown to lead to very efficient PLU in GaInNP/GaAs heterostructures grown by gas source molecular beam epitaxy (GS‐MBE). This is attributed to the N‐induced changes in the band alignment at the GaInNP/GaAs heterointerface from the type I for the N‐free structure to the type II in the samples with N compositions exceeding 0.5%. Based on the performed excitation power dependent measurements, a possible mechanism for the energy upconversion is suggested as being due to the two‐step two‐photon absorption. The photon recycling effect is shown to be important for the structures with N=1%, from time‐resolved PL measurements. © 2007 American Institute of Physics
